Trasplante de médula ósea para la enfermedad de células falciformes utilizando ciclofosfamida post-trasplante y TBI
Marti Goldenberg1, Ravi Varadhan1, Christopher J Gamper2
1Johns Hopkins University, Baltimore, Maryland, United States.
Abstract:
Reduced intensity conditioning (RIC), haploidentical donors, and post-transplantation cyclophosphamide (PTCy) have overcome many barriers associated with bone marrow transplantation (BMT) for sickle cell disease (SCD). However, initial approaches had high graft failure rates. Our preliminary data suggested increasing the total body irradiation (TBI) dose from 200 to 400 cGy could improve engraftment. This study included SCD patients aged 2-70 undergoing BMT from November 2014 - January 2025. The regimen included anti-thymocyte globulin, fludarabine, cyclophosphamide, and single fraction 400 cGy TBI. Graft-vs-host disease (GVHD) prophylaxis included PTCy, mycophenolate mofetil, and sirolimus. Outcomes measured were disease-free survival (DFS), graft failure, overall survival (OS), and GVHD incidence. Forty-three patients (median age 23) were transplanted. Thirty-four (79%) had >2 indications for BMT and all had >2 SCD comorbidities. Five-year OS probability was 95.5% (CI 0.87 - 1.0) at a median follow-up of 2.43 years. DFS probability at 2 years was 94.5% (CI 0.87 - 1.0) with only 2 (5%) graft failures. Two patients died late (2.5 and 6 years) after BMT. The cumulative incidence of grades 3-4 acute GVHD was 2.4% (CI 0 - 0.07) and moderate-severe chronic GVHD was 7.3% (CI 0 - 0.15). Median time to discontinuation of immunosuppression was 354 days. Of the 27 female patients, 12 had return of menses and/or normalized gonadal function. RIC haploidentical BMT with 400 cGy maintained a low toxicity profile, provides high rates of durable engraftment, and may preserve fertility. This regimen expands the availability of curative therapy for severe SCD. NCT00489281.
